Federal Reference and Equivalent Methods for Measuring Fine Particulate Matter

Pages 457-464 | Published online: 30 Nov 2010
 

In the national ambient air quality standards specified by the U.S. Environmental Protection Agency in the Code of Federal Regulations, new standards were established for particulate matter on July 18, 1997.
